Among Reformed Christians, the celebration of the anniversary of the Synod of Dordt (1618-19) is second only to the commemoration of the Reformation of the sixteenth century. Indeed, marking the anniversary of the "great synod," as it soon was called, is commemoration of the Reformation. For mainly Dordt's accomplishment was the preservation of the gospel of God's sovereign grace, which was restored to the church through the Reformation.
The Protestant Reformed Theological Seminary held a conference to celebrate the four hundredth anniversary of the Synod of Dordt. For God's Glory and the Church's Consolation includes all the presentations made at this conference, plus a bit more. The book explores the heritage that faithful Reformed churches ought to esteem, as that heritage was defended and handed down by the Synod of Dordt.
The chapters included in this book are written by: Rev. Angus Stewart, Prof. Brian Huizinga, Rev. Mark Shand, Prof. Douglas Kuiper, Rev. William Langerak, Prof. Ronald Cammenga, and Prof. Barrett Gritters.
